A few things about the Game Gear.

1. Get the AC adapter. It eats 6 AAs in about 4 hours.
2. Shining Force 2 Sword of Hadja is pretty good, as long as you don't already have Shining Force CD. The Goblins look like ass, but all the rest of the in-battle graphics are pretty good looking.

There is actually quite a bit of decent software for the game gear. When Looking for a used one I found out the hard way to make sure to ask about sound volume as with the Turbo Express the Game Gear has a thing for failing audio. As for the games here are a few I have enjoyed.

Sonic
Sonic 2
Sonic Chaos
Battletoads
Double Dragon
Streets Of Rage
Megaman
X-men Mojo World
Shinobi
Shinobi 2
Ninja Gaiden
Mickey Mouse legend of illusion
Mickey Mouse Castle of Illusion
Columns
Baku Baku
Bubble Bobble

Most can be had for dirt cheap and machines are about $5 if you look carefully just make sure to have a genesis 2 power adapter handy because it chews through batteries.
